"""test flow with otp stages"""
from base64 import b32decode
from time import sleep
from urllib.parse import parse_qs, urlparse
from selenium.webdriver.common.by import By
from selenium.webdriver.common.keys import Keys
from selenium.webdriver.support import expected_conditions as ec
from selenium.webdriver.support.wait import WebDriverWait
from authentik.blueprints.tests import apply_blueprint
from authentik.flows.models import Flow
from authentik.stages.authenticator.oath import TOTP
from authentik.stages.authenticator_static.models import (
AuthenticatorStaticStage,
StaticDevice,
StaticToken,
)
from authentik.stages.authenticator_totp.models import AuthenticatorTOTPStage, TOTPDevice
from tests.e2e.utils import SeleniumTestCase, retry
class TestFlowsAuthenticator(SeleniumTestCase):
"""test flow with otp stages"""
@retry()
@apply_blueprint(
"default/flow-default-authentication-flow.yaml",
"default/flow-default-invalidation-flow.yaml",
)
def test_totp_validate(self):
"""test flow with otp stages"""
# Setup TOTP Device
device = TOTPDevice.objects.create(user=self.user, confirmed=True, digits=6)
flow: Flow = Flow.objects.get(slug="default-authentication-flow")
self.driver.get(self.url("authentik_core:if-flow", flow_slug=flow.slug))
self.login()
# Get expected token
totp = TOTP(device.bin_key, device.step, device.t0, device.digits, device.drift)
flow_executor = self.get_shadow_root("ak-flow-executor")
validation_stage = self.get_shadow_root("ak-stage-authenticator-validate", flow_executor)
code_stage = self.get_shadow_root("ak-stage-authenticator-validate-code", validation_stage)
code_stage.find_element(By.CSS_SELECTOR, "input[name=code]").send_keys(totp.token())
code_stage.find_element(By.CSS_SELECTOR, "input[name=code]").send_keys(Keys.ENTER)
self.wait_for_url(self.if_user_url("/library"))
self.assert_user(self.user)
@retry()
@apply_blueprint(
"default/flow-default-authentication-flow.yaml",
"default/flow-default-invalidation-flow.yaml",
)
@apply_blueprint("default/flow-default-authenticator-totp-setup.yaml")
def test_totp_setup(self):
"""test TOTP Setup stage"""
flow: Flow = Flow.objects.get(slug="default-authentication-flow")
self.driver.get(self.url("authentik_core:if-flow", flow_slug=flow.slug))
self.login()
self.wait_for_url(self.if_user_url("/library"))
self.assert_user(self.user)
self.driver.get(
self.url(
"authentik_flows:configure",
stage_uuid=AuthenticatorTOTPStage.objects.first().stage_uuid,
)
)
flow_executor = self.get_shadow_root("ak-flow-executor")
totp_stage = self.get_shadow_root("ak-stage-authenticator-totp", flow_executor)
wait = WebDriverWait(totp_stage, self.wait_timeout)
wait.until(ec.presence_of_element_located((By.CSS_SELECTOR, "input[name=otp_uri]")))
otp_uri = totp_stage.find_element(By.CSS_SELECTOR, "input[name=otp_uri]").get_attribute(
"value"
)
# Parse the OTP URI, extract the secret and get the next token
otp_args = urlparse(otp_uri)
self.assertEqual(otp_args.scheme, "otpauth")
otp_qs = parse_qs(otp_args.query)
secret_key = b32decode(otp_qs["secret"][0])
totp = TOTP(secret_key)
totp_stage.find_element(By.CSS_SELECTOR, "input[name=code]").send_keys(totp.token())
totp_stage.find_element(By.CSS_SELECTOR, "input[name=code]").send_keys(Keys.ENTER)
sleep(3)
self.assertTrue(TOTPDevice.objects.filter(user=self.user, confirmed=True).exists())
@retry()
@apply_blueprint(
"default/flow-default-authentication-flow.yaml",
"default/flow-default-invalidation-flow.yaml",
)
@apply_blueprint("default/flow-default-authenticator-static-setup.yaml")
def test_static_setup(self):
"""test Static OTP Setup stage"""
flow: Flow = Flow.objects.get(slug="default-authentication-flow")
self.driver.get(self.url("authentik_core:if-flow", flow_slug=flow.slug))
self.login()
self.wait_for_url(self.if_user_url("/library"))
self.assert_user(self.user)
self.driver.get(
self.url(
"authentik_flows:configure",
stage_uuid=AuthenticatorStaticStage.objects.first().stage_uuid,
)
)
# Remember the current URL as we should end up back here
destination_url = self.driver.current_url
flow_executor = self.get_shadow_root("ak-flow-executor")
authenticator_stage = self.get_shadow_root("ak-stage-authenticator-static", flow_executor)
token = authenticator_stage.find_element(By.CSS_SELECTOR, "ul li:nth-child(1)").text
authenticator_stage.find_element(By.CSS_SELECTOR, "button[type=submit]").click()
self.wait_for_url(destination_url)
sleep(1)
self.assertTrue(StaticDevice.objects.filter(user=self.user, confirmed=True).exists())
device = StaticDevice.objects.filter(user=self.user, confirmed=True).first()
self.assertTrue(StaticToken.objects.filter(token=token, device=device).exists())
